pub struct Button<S: State, W: Widget<S> + 'static> { /* private fields */ }Expand description
An interactive area with a child widget that runs a closure when pressed.
See the counter example for how to use it in practice.
§Theming
Styling the button require following properties:
color_pressed- The color of the button when pressed.color_idle- The color of the button when not pressed and not hovered (idling).color_hovered- The color of the button when hovered on.
